Join Cleveland Clinic’s Stuart Surgery Center where research is advanced, technology is leading-edge, patient care is world-class, and caregivers are family. Stuart Surgery Center is an outpatient endoscopic facility specializing in colorectal cancer screening and problems involving the digestive tract. This facility provides the communities in and around Stuart with high-quality, patient focused care. 

 

As an Office Coordinator, you will support clinic operations by collaborating with physicians, nurses and other caregivers. Your primary duties will include, but are not limited to:   

  • Answering and triaging phone calls.    

  • Scheduling appointments, diagnostic testing and surgical procedures.    

  • Obtaining referrals and authorizations.    

  • Maintaining physicians’ calendars.    

The ideal future caregiver is someone who:   

  • Has excellent interpersonal, communication and customer service skills.   

  • Demonstrates a strong work ethic.   

  • Thrives in a team environment.   

  • Can multi-task while paying attention to details and staying organized.

Responsibilities:

  • Supports clinic operations by direct involvement with the physician(s) and nurse(s).
  • Facilitates the access of patients to CCF through direct patient appointment scheduling or by serving as a liaison between patient and/or other medical departments.
  • Works through and solves patient issues professionally and in a timely manner. Produces error-free transcribed correspondence.
  • Takes and relays phone messages for the respective area in a clear and concise manner in accordance to CCF policy. Assists with calendar, meeting, and travel arrangements as requested and ensures proper forms are completed.
  • Ensures all patients are rescheduled relating to physician out days in a timely manner.
  • Orders supplies using cost effectively, appropriate cost center numbers and correct processes.
  • Utilizes correct pathway to retrieve lab and radiology reports (via Net Access) and dictated reports (via Total eMed) as needed.
  • Verifies and updates patient demographics and insurance information.
  • Identifies whether patient needs referral and/or authorization and obtains referral and/or authorization when necessary.
  • Ensures appointments are booked on proper case and add any cases or schemes as necessary.
  • Obtains proper information such as PCP, referring physician, CPT/DX codes prior to entering request into referral module.
  • Inputs reasons for all visits on all appointments. Ensures same day add-on appointment is communicated to appropriate department personnel. Ensures authorization is secured for same day add-on appointment and same day inpatient hospital admissions.
  • Ensures surgery packets are completed correctly and delivered in at timely manner to OPS and Access Plus.
  • Works in conjunction with nurse to reconcile day sheet with charge tickets.
  • Assists other departments within the pod as needed.
  • Maintains complete and up-to-date documentation and files at all times, including product and service quotes.
  • Other duties as assigned.
